Industrial Organic ChemistryBy Klaus Weissermel, Hans-Jurgen Arpe

This textbook concisely describes the most important precursors and intermediates of industrial organic chemistry. It is designed for students who need to follow the development of manufacturing processes, teachers who want to glean information about applied organic synthesis and the constant change of manufacturing processes and feedstocks, and those in the chemical industry - engineers, marketing specialists, lawyers, and industrial economists - who want to understand complex technological, scientific, and economic interrelationships and their potential developments.

Review
"The fourth edition of this established work follows in the excellent tradition of the previous three editions. It retains the concept of the original, providing technological and economic information on the key building blocks of the chemical industry.
The book is packed with information, much of which cannot easily be found elsewhere, and certainly not in such a readily digestible form. The companies and innivators responsible for the chemistry described are clearly credited, and indeed this volume provides an excellent history of the worldwide bulk organic chemicals industry. Throughout the book the authors indicate potential future developments in the manufacture of these important precursors and intermediates.
The reader frindly format seen in the previous editions is retained, wherein each chapter or subsection is provided with a chemical flow diagram illustrating the interrelationship of the products, these flow diagrams folding aut such that they can be constantly referred to whilst reading the text. In addition, the main text is accompained by a synopsis in the margin, which concisely presents all of the essential points, thus facilitating browsing. The contents are logically and clearly organised, and there are detailed reference lists for each chapter, togehter with an extensive index. This latest edition also includes updated statistics and adopts the new IUPAC nomenclature guidelines.(...) This book will be a positive addition to the libraries and bookshelves of chemists and chemical engineers working in the organic sector, including those to whom many of the molecules describes are considered to be "commercially available starting materials". Non-scientists (e.g. industrial economists, lawyers) will also gain a appreciation of the complex technologicial, scientific and economic inter-relationshops (and potential developments) which characterise industrial organic chemistry." Organic Process Research & Development, Peter Spargo

About the Author
Professor Hans-J?rgen Arpe studied chemistry at the Christian-Albert-University in Kiel, Germany and where he also received his PhD under guidance of Professor R. Grewe. Hans-J?rgen Arpe commenced his career at the Koninklijke/ Shell-Laboratory in Amsterdam, The Netherlands. He then moved to the Shell Research Laboratories near Bonn, Germany, followed by his appoint as Head of the Research Department Aliphatic Intermediates at Hoechst AG, Frankfurt, Germany and Head of the scientific library of Hoechst AG. Professor Arpe was an Honorary Professor at the Friedrich-Alexander-University Erlangen, Germany.
